fichier hal.dll endommagé lors du démarrage de xp

fichier hal.dll endommagé lors du démarrage de xp - Win NT/2K/XP - Windows & Software

Marsh Posté le 03-05-2005 à 19:27:22    

Hello à tous j'ai donc le fichier hal.dll qui se trouve endommagé et je ne peux plus redemarrer mon windows. (j'ai reinstall un autr esytem sur un vieux DD pour resoudre le pb..)
 
Au debut j'ai fait une rechreche sur le disque et en fait le fichier en question portait un nom tout en capital j'ai donc reinscrit en bas de casse mais le pb est resté. J'ai ensuite remplacer le fichier par celui du sytem que je venais d'installer -> toujours pareil  :fou:  je test en prenant le fichier sur le cd de windows et je rencontre encore c'est bon sang d'erreur !!!!
 
après avoir pris mon courage à 2 main et effectué qques recherche sur le net je tiombe sur un article qui explique comment résoudre le pb sur le site de micro hebdo.
 

Citation :

Windows XP réclame Hall.dll pour démarrer
 
La rédaction , Micro Hebdo, le 04/11/2004 à 00h00
 
 
J'utilise Windows XP et je ne peux plus démarrer mon micro. Il se bloque toujours sur un message qui me dit que le fichier Hal.dll est absent ou endommagé. Comment faire ?Jérôme Capon
 
A moins de réinstaller Windows, il vous faut utiliser la Console de récupération pour résoudre votre problème. Il est possible, si vous possédez un ordinateur ancien, que vous soyez obligé de modifier le bios afin de placer le lecteur de CD-Rom en première position de démarrage (boot) pour pouvoir utiliser le CD de Windows XP, dont vous avez besoin pour cette opération.1 Placez le CD de Windows XP dans le lecteur de CD-Rom et redémarrez votre micro. Lorsque l'écran de bienvenue apparaît, appuyez sur la touche R du clavier pour lancer la fonction Réparation. Dans l'écran suivant, répondez aux questions qui vous sont posées. Par exemple, à la question « Sur quelle installation de Windows voulez-vous ouvrir une session ? », il faut taper le chiffre 1 (à moins que vous ayez plusieurs installations de Windows) et appuyer sur Entrée. Vous devrez peut-être appuyer sur la touche Verr num pour pou-voir utiliser le pavé numérique. Tapez enfin votre mot de passe administrateur, si vous en avez un, et appuyez sur Entrée.2 Lorsque l'invite C:\Windows> s'affiche et tout en respectant les espaces représentés par un point (*), tapez la ligne de commande suivante : Expand*D:\i386\Driver.cab*-F:hal. dll*C:\Windows\System32\ puis appuyez sur Entrée.Il est probable qu'un message vous demande alors de confirmer le remplacement du fichier Hal.dll. Dans ce cas, tapez la lettre O (pour Oui) et appuyez sur Entrée.Si votre lecteur de CD-Rom possède une autre lettre que D, par exemple E, la commande à taper est alors : Expand*E:\i386\Driver.cab*-F:hal. dll*C:\Windows\System32\Enfin, lorsque l'invite C:\Windows> réapparaît, tapez Exit et appuyez sur Entrée pour redémarrer votre micro


 
(c'est la solution que donne quelqu'un sur ce forum mais expliqué un peu mieux car je n'avais pas vraiment compris ce qu'il fallait faire sur le message de ce forum lol, http://forum.hardware.fr/forum2.ph [...] ash_post=0 )
 
je fais donc tout cela, j'ai bien le message me demandant si je veux remplacer le fichier, je tape exit le pc redammre donc.. et me remet la même erreur  :o  :fou:  :pfff:  
 
quelqu'un de vous pourrais me donner une autre solution à tester svp ?

Reply

Marsh Posté le 03-05-2005 à 19:27:22   

Reply

Marsh Posté le 03-05-2005 à 21:28:02    

Salut,
 
Ceci peut aussi arriver quand ton boot.ini n'est plus valide. Tu peux démarrer avec le CD puis choisir Réparer à la première demande pour accéder à la console de récup, puis faire :
bootcfg /rebuild pour reconstruire ce fichier.
 
Aux cas où ton secteur de boot serait corrompu, tente aussi :
fixmbr
et
fixboot C:
pour le corriger.

Reply

Marsh Posté le 03-05-2005 à 22:54:17    

wackevat a écrit :

Salut,
 
Ceci peut aussi arriver quand ton boot.ini n'est plus valide. Tu peux démarrer avec le CD puis choisir Réparer à la première demande pour accéder à la console de récup, puis faire :
bootcfg /rebuild pour reconstruire ce fichier.
 
Aux cas où ton secteur de boot serait corrompu, tente aussi :
fixmbr
et
fixboot C:
pour le corriger.


 
dc en fait je dois ecrire après c:\windows (le * represente une espace):  
 
bootcfg*\rebuilt*boot.ini
 
puis ensuite (si je ne demarre tjrs pas) :
fixmbr*\fixboot*c:
 
c'est bien ça  :sweat:

Reply

Marsh Posté le 03-05-2005 à 23:12:51    

Non, si on reprend ta convention (* pour espace) :
 
Après C:\Windows, tu commences par écrire :
fixmbr
et tu valides.
Puis
fixboot*C:
et tu valides.
Et enfin :
bootcfg*/rebuild
et tu valides.
 
 

Reply

Marsh Posté le 06-05-2005 à 22:02:50    

Ce genre de problème peut aussi survenir si ton disque possede des secteurs defectueux.
 
Dans ce cas tu peux taper, tjrs dans la console de récupération : C:\chkdsk*/F  
(ce qui signifie chek disk)
/F pour réparer les erreurs
/R localise les secteurs défectueux et les récupéres
 
Bonne chance !
 
Radrim

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ed